Best attractions and places to see around La Bâtie-Vieille are located in the Hautes-Alpes department, offering a blend of historical landmarks and natural features. This commune is situated opposite the Ecrins National Park, providing a mountainous backdrop for exploration. Visitors can discover ancient structures like the 12th-century tower and enjoy proximity to natural sites such as Lake Serre-Ponçon. The area is conducive to outdoor activities, including hiking on historical routes and enjoying panoramic views.

Connecting the Gapençais and the Durance valley, the Lebraut pass is a magnificent viewpoint over the Serre-Ponçon lake. Small roads that are as discreet as they are panoramic provide access to the heart of resplendent nature.

The church of Gap, dedicated to Notre-Dame and Saint-Arnoux, is a Catholic church located in the town of Gap, in the Hautes-Alpes in France. Built between the 19th and early 20th centuries, it features a mix of neo-Gothic and neo-Romanesque architecture. Its impressive exterior is dominated by two symmetrical towers, while its spacious interior is decorated with colorful stained glass windows and religious ornaments. Gap Church is an important place of worship and architectural landmark in the city.

From Chorges, after a demanding climb in the middle of the forest, you reach a great viewpoint called “LE RUBAN”. From there we have a magnificent view of Lake Serre-Ponçon. The descent is also done along the same path, passing through the small village of Fein. This route has a lot of shade and gains a lot of altitude, making it ideal for when it's hot.

La Bâtie-Vieille is rich in history. You can explore the 12th-Century Tower (Tour du XIIe siècle), an ancient watchtower that dominates the village. Other notable historical buildings include the 19th-century Saint-Martin Church and the Saint-Antoine Chapel of Grand-Larra. The nearby Chorges Village Center also offers historical charm with its narrow streets.

For breathtaking vistas, head to Col de Moissière (1573 m), a mountain pass offering a fabulous panorama at its summit. Another excellent spot is Le Ruban, a viewpoint providing grand vistas of Lake Serre-Ponçon and its surrounding landscape. The region also offers superb panoramas from routes on the plateau of Rambaud or the ascent to Puy Maurel.

Absolutely. La Bâtie-Vieille is situated opposite the renowned Ecrins National Park, offering stunning mountain scenery and biodiversity. Approximately 20 km away, you'll find Lake Serre-Ponçon, Europe's largest artificial lake, perfect for swimming, stand-up paddling, kayaking, and boat trips.
The Sentier Historique de La Bâtie-Vieille is a peaceful trail that combines nature and heritage. It features historical curiosities of the village and offers beautiful panoramic views of the Champsaur region, making it a great option for a leisurely walk.
Gap is a settlement located in a wide flat valley surrounded by mountains, known for its exceptional geographical location. It benefits from over 300 days of sunshine annually, making it a bright and pleasant place to visit. The city also features the impressive Gap church (cathedral), an architectural landmark.
